WHITE MAGIC
FEEDING THE: DUMB. A noted scientist who wrote an enthralling hook about the men and animals of the New Hebrides, where Frame and Britain play at comic opera government, tells the story of the native who came to him about a dug. It appears that the dog was a nonbarker and was therefore no good whatever to a man who wanted a watch dog to warn him when Christianised natives ,cnmc round on a pig-pinching expedition. In pidgin Knglish (which is not here used) he begged for a hit of dynamite. He knew that when dynamite exploded it made large noise, lie explained lu the boss that he wanted Lo put the i|viiamite in a bit ol meat for the dog to eat so that the dog, having swallowed the potential’ noise, would reproduce the row when the thieves came round. The obliging scientist gave him a scrap of explosive, knowing, of course, that it was relatively harmless without: moans of detonation, and the box left delighted. Later lie reported that jj, 0 dog had swallowed the dynamite ami next day harked slightly! 'l he |■ :v alter lie harked loudly, and was then, thanks to the boss’ kindness, in a perpetual state ol hark. When, however, the man applied for a few flicks of gelignite to feed to a deaf mu! dumb friend the scientist relused the boon-
